The online Master of Public Administration is designed for those with professional goals related to public service in areas such as government agencies, health organizations, justice administration and law enforcement, as well as non-profit organizations and the private sector. The program provides professional education and leadership skills for effective, efficient, and responsive public service necessary for individuals preparing for, or currently serving in, public service careers.
Students learn to:
- Participate in and contribute to the public policy process
- Think critically
- Articulate and apply a public service perspective
- Communicate effectively
- Interact productively with a diverse and changing workforce and citizenry
